AES Announces Dates For 130th & 131st 2011 Conventions May 13 – 16, London/October 20 – 23, NYC

NEW YORK: Audio Engineering Society

javits-center-nyc-night-low-res.jpg

Executive Director Roger Furness has announced that the 130th AES Convention will be held in the Novotel London West Convention Centre, Friday, May 13 – Monday, May 16. The 131st Convention is confirmed for NYC’s Jacob Javits Center, Thursday, October 20 thru Sunday, Oct. 23.

“Extraordinarily positive attendee and exhibitor feedback confirmed the success of our 129th Convention in San Francisco this past November,” Furness said. “We received high marks on all levels, technical, social and organizational. A palpable sense of optimism permeated the entire event.

“Our Convention Committees have already begun the year-long process of developing both these major 2011 events. The call for papers has been posted for the London Convention, and NY Convention Chair Jim Anderson meets this week with our Committee here to begin plans for October,” Furness adds.

LITTLE ROCK FOX AFFILIATE KLRT ADOPTS JVC PROHD CAMERAS FOR STUDIO, ENG USE

WAYNE, NJ – JVC Professional Products Company today announced that KLRT, the FOX affiliate in Little Rock, Ark., has adopted JVC ProHD cameras for studio and ENG use. The Newport Television station, which serves the Little Rock-Pine Bluff market (DMA #56), purchased four GY-HD250Us to replace Thomson LDK 1707s as its main studio cameras for daily newscasts, as well as eight GY-HM700U cameras for ENG use. FOX16 News went live with its new studio cameras yesterday, and has been using its new GY-HM700s in the field since August.

image005.jpg

Ideal for ENG work, the GY-HM700 is a compact, shoulder-mount camcorder with three 1/3-inch progressive scan CCDs. It records full 1280×720 and 1920×1080 images, and its proprietary MPEG-2 encoder supports all major HD signal formats, including 1080i and 720p. Red Bank, N.J., December 14, 2010— OneCall Manage, provider of a systems-thinking infrastructure for wireless management, today announced that its wireless management software suite has business intelligence (BI) level database access and report generation capabilities.

Key attributes of BI software are its ability to access hidden, granular data, and then present that data from any point of view the user chooses. Further, BI software translates that data into natural language, and auto-generates a single report that enables CFOs and other executives to problem solve discretely. If that software can also access dynamic data on the fly and include it in the report’s point of view, the ante of BI is upped to be labeled analytics-driven BI software.
